Installation & Application Notes

Disconnect main battery before working on electrical components. Use dielectric grease on all connector pins. Check ground connections — most electrical faults trace to poor grounds. Test with multimeter before installing new parts.

Failure Symptoms

An initial sign of a failing oil pressure gauge is erratic needle movement or inconsistent readings. If left unaddressed, the gauge may cease to provide any indication of oil pressure, leaving the operator unaware of a critical lubrication problem. This lack of information can lead to severe engine damage due to prolonged operation without adequate lubrication.

Installation Tip

Ensure the engine is completely cool before attempting to remove the old gauge or install the new one. Avoid overtightening the gauge into its fitting, as this can damage the threads or the gauge housing.

Service Note

Inspect the oil pressure sender unit and its electrical connections for any signs of wear, corrosion, or damage.
